版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
Access2010数据库应用(第二版)江西农业大学计算机与信息工程学院信息管理与信息系统教研室学习要点创建空白数据库使用模版创建数据库数据库的打开、关闭和保存备份数据库设置数据库的属性对数据库对象的组织与操作第二章数据库的基本操作学习目标通过本章的学习,读者应该学会创建和管理数据库,掌握建立数据库的各种方法,并能熟练使用数据库的基本操作。读者还应学会如何管理数据库,以及对数据库进行备份和压缩等操作,以保证数据库的运行速率及其安全性。第二章数据库的基本操作2.1.1数据库“数据库”是指长期储存在计算机内、有组织的、可共享的大量数据的集合。数据库系统是计算机应用系统中一种专门管理数据资源的系统,可以将海量的、多类型的、结构复杂的数据按照一定秩序组织与管理,使之为不同的用户的使用服务。数据库技术的发展体现了计算机技术的不断进剑髦质菘夤理系统层出不穷,数据库技术的出现,不仅降低了数据处理成本,提高了数据处理效率,而且增强了数据处理的可靠性。数据库技术的应用日益广泛,Access2010就是其中的一种。Access2010将所有的数据对象存储在ACCDB文件中,使得我们可以方便快捷的创建和操作数据库。Access2010数据库管理系统操作直观、使用灵活、编程方便等特点,其处理能力适用于中小型数据库管理。2.1认识数据库在Access2010中,提供了两种建立数据库的方法,既可以直接建立一个空白数据库,也可以使用数据库建立向导。建立了数据库以后,就可以在里面添加表、查询、窗体等数据库对象了。另外,Access2010还提供了两类数据库的创建,即:网络数据库和传统数据库,本书主要介绍传统数据库。下面将分别介绍创建数据库的这两种方法。2.2建立新数据库
如果没有找到满足需要的数据库模版,或者在不知道有哪些数据库模版,以及要从另一个程序中导入数据的话,那么最好先建立一个空白数据库。空白数据库就是搭起一个数据库的框架起来,但是其中没有任何的对象和数据。创建好了空白数据库后,再根据实际需求,向其中添加所需的表、查询、窗体、宏等对象,这样能够灵活地创建更加符合实际需要的数据库系统。但是由于需要用户自己动手创建各个对象,因此操作较为复杂。创建空白数据库一般用于创建有较多复杂的对象但又没有合适的数据库模版的情况。建立一个空数据库的操作步骤如下。2.2.1创建一个空白数据库1.启动Access2010程序,并进入Backstage视图,然后在左侧导航窗格中单击【新建】命令,接着在中间窗格中单击【空数据库】选项,如下图所示。创建一个空白数据库操作步骤2.在右侧窗格中下方的【文件名】文本框中默认文件名为“Database1.accdb”,如右上图所示在该文本框输入新建文件的名称,再单击【创建】图标按钮;或者单击文本框右侧的浏览按钮,打开【文件新建数据库】对话框,设置存储路径,并输入新数据库的名称,再单击【确定】按钮,如右下图所示,再回到Access2010窗口,单击【创建】图标按钮。创建一个空白数据库操作步骤3.此时,新建了一个空白数据库,在Access2010窗口的标题栏中可以看到该数据库的名称,同时在该数据库中自动创建一个数据表,并以数据工作表视图的方式打开该表,如下图所示。创建一个空白数据库操作步骤4.创建了数据库以后,就可以为数据库添加表、查询等数据库对象了。一般而言,表作为数据库中各种数据的唯一载体,往往是应该最先创建的。至于如何在数据库中创建数据表,以及如何设计数据表的结构等内容,将在后面章节中进行介绍。运用这种方法,Access2010大大提高了建立数据库的简易程度。运用这种方法建立的数据库,可以更加有针对性地设计自己所需要的数据库系统,相对于被动地用模板而言,增强了使用者的主动性。创建一个空白数据库操作步骤使用模版是创建数据库的最快方式,Access2010提供了12个数据库模板,如果其中有与需求最接近的模版,则使用模版创建数据库最快捷。使用数据库模板,用户只需要进行一些简单操作,就可以创建一个包含了表、查询等数据库对象的数据库系统。下面利用Access2010中的可用模板,创建一个“教职员”数据库,具体操作步骤如下。2.2.2利用模板创建数据库1.启动Access2010,如图2-1所示,单击屏幕左上角的【文件】标签,在打开的Backstage视图中选择【新建】命令,然后单击【样本模版】图标按钮。此时,进入“可用模版”界面,从列出的12个模板中选择需要的模板,这里选择【教职员数据库】选项,如图所示。创建“教职员”数据库操作步骤2.在屏幕右下方弹出的【数据库名称】中输入想要采用的数据库文件名,然后单击【创建】按钮,完成数据库的创建。创建的数据库如图示。创建“教职员”数据库操作步骤3.这样就利用模板创建了“教职员”数据库。单击【新建教职员】命令按钮,弹出如【教职员详细信息】对话框,如图即可输入新的教职员详细信息了;或者单击“ID”字段下方的“(新建)”字样,也可以弹出【教职员详细信息】对话框,添加新的数据。创建“教职员”数据库操作步骤或者,单击“姓氏”等字段名称下方单元格,直接输入新的教职员的各项信息,如图2-8所示。创建“教职员”数据库操作步骤可见,通过数据库模板可以创建专业的数据库系统,但是这些系统有时不太符合要求,因此最简便的方法就是先利用模板生成一个数据库,然后再进行修改,使其符合要求。创建“教职员”数据库操作步骤除了可以使用Access2010提供的本地方法创建数据库之外,还可以利用Internet上的网络资源。如图,在O的网站搜索所需的模版后,把模版下载到本地计算机中,就可以使用该模版创建数据库。数据库的打开、关闭与保存是数据库最基本的操作,对于学习数据库是必不可少的。本节,我们将学习数据库的打开、关闭与保存的操作方法。2.3打开、关闭与保存数据库在创建了数据库后,以后用到数据库时就需要打开已创建的数据库,这是数据库操作中最基本、最简单的操作,下面就以实例介绍如何打开数据库。2.3.1打开数据库1.启动Access2010,单击屏幕左上角的【文件】标签,在打开的Backstage视图中选择【打开】命令,如图所示。打开数据库操作步骤2.在弹出的【打开】对话框中选择要打开的文件,单击【打开】按钮,即可打开选中的数据库,如图所示。
打开数据库操作步骤Access2010中自动记忆了最近打开过的数据库。对于最近使用过的文件,只需要单击【文件】标签,并在打开的Backstage视图中选择【最近所用文件】命令,接着在右侧窗格中直接单击要打开的数据库名称即可,如图所示。打开数据库或者,只需要单击【文件】标签,也会出现最近打开过的数据库文件,如图所示。打开数据库还可以通过使用快捷键来新建和打开数据库,方法如下:按下Ctrl+N组合键,新建一个空数据库。按下Ctrl+O组合键,打开一个数据库。创建数据库,并为数据库添加了表、视图等数据库对象后,接下来要将数据库保存,以保存添加的项目。另外,用户在处理数据库时,要做到随时保存,以免出现错误导致大量数据丢失。
2.3.2保存数据库1.单击屏幕左上角的【文件】标签,在打开的Backstage视图中选择【保存】命令,即可保存输入的信息,如图所示。保存数据库操作步骤2.选择【数据库另存为】命令,可更改数据库的保存位置和文件名,如图所示。保存数据库操作步骤3.弹出MicrosoftAccess对话框,提示保存数据库前必须关闭所有打开的对象,单击【是】按钮即可,如图所示。保存数据库操作步骤4.弹出【另存为】对话框,选择文件的存放位置,然后在【文件名】文本框中输入文件名称,单击【保存】按钮即可,如图所示。保存数据库操作步骤还可以通过单击快速访问工具栏中的【保存】按钮或是按下Ctrl+S组合键来保存编辑后的文件。经常性的备份数据库,可以有效地保护数据库的安全性,避免在电脑软硬件出现重大错误时将数据全部丢失。保存数据库操作步骤在完成了数据库的保存后,当不再需要使用数据库时,就可以关闭数据库了。2.3.3关闭数据库1.单击屏幕右上角的【关闭】按钮,即可关闭数据库,如图所示。关闭数据库操作步骤2.或者单击左上角的【文件】标签,在打开的Backstage视图中选择【关闭数据库】命令,即可关闭数据库,如图所示。关闭数据库操作步骤在数据库的使用过程中,随着使用次数越来越多,难免会产生大量的垃圾数据,使数据库变得异常庞大,如何去除这些无效数据呢?为了数据的安全,备份数据库是最简单的方法,在Access中数据库又是如何备份的呢?还有打开一个数据库以后,如何查看这个数据库的各种信息呢?所有的问题都可以在数据库的管理菜单下解决,下面就介绍基本的数据库管理方法。2.4管理数据库对数据库进行备份,是最常用的安全措施。下面以备份“教职员.accdb”数据库文件为例,介绍如何在Access2010中备份数据库。2.4.1备份数据库1.在Access2010程序中打开“教职员.accdb”数据库,如图所示然后单击【文件】标签,并在打开的Backstage视图中选择【保存并发布】命令,选择右侧下方的【备份数据库】选项,并单击【另存为】图标按钮。备份数据库操作步骤
2.系统将弹出【另存为】对话框,默认的备份文件名为“数据库名+备份日期”,如图所示。备份数据库操作步骤3.单击【保存】按钮,即可完成数据库的备份。数据库的备份功能类似于文件的【另存为】功能,其实利用Windows的【复制】功能或者Access的【另存为】功能都可以完成数据库的备份工作。备份数据库操作步骤对于一个新打开的数据库,可以通过查看数据库属性,来了解数据库的相关信息。下面以查看和编辑“教职员”数据库的属性为例进行介绍,具体操作步骤如下。2.4.2查看和编辑数据库属性1.启动Access2010,打开任意一个数据库文件。
2.单击屏幕左上角的【文件】标签,在打开的Backstage视图中选择【信息】命令,再选择右侧上方的【查看和编辑数据库属性】按钮,如图所示。查看和编辑数据库属性操作步骤3.在弹出的数据库属性对话框的【常规】选项卡中显示了文件类型、存储位置与大小等信息,如图所示。查看和编辑数据库属性操作步骤4.在“教职员.accdb属性”对话框中,单击【摘要】选项卡,可以看到该数据库的“标题”、“主题”、“作者”、“经理”、“单位”、“类别”、“关键词”、“备注”、“超链接基础”等信息,如图所示。为了便于以后的管理,建议尽可能地填写【摘要】选项卡的信息。这样即使是下一个人进行数据库维护,也能清楚数据库的内容。查看和编辑数据库属性操作步骤5.在“教职员.accdb属性”对话框中,单击【统计】选项卡,如图所示,可以看到该数据库的创建、修改、访问和打印的时间、以及该数据库上次保持者、修订次数和编辑时间总计的信息。查看和编辑数据库属性操作步骤6.在“教职员.accdb属性”对话框中,单击【内容】选项卡,如图所示,可以看到该数据库的文档内容,从中可以知道该数据库中包括哪些表、查询、窗体、报表、数据访问页等数据库对象的信息。查看和编辑数据库属性操作步骤7.在“教职员.accdb属性”对话框中,单击【自定义】选项卡,如图所示,可以自定义该数据库的属性。查看和编辑数据库属性操作步骤8.在【自定义】选项卡,单击属性列表,然后可以从名称下拉列表中选择要添加的属性,如图所示,选中了要添加的属性之后,单击【添加】按钮,则该属性出现在属性列表中。查看和编辑数据库属性操作步骤Access数据库的对象主要有6类对象:表、查询、窗体、报表、宏和模块,在Access2010中,提供了多种方式组织数据库对象,以方便用户管理。在Access2010工作窗口左下方的导航窗格,如图所示,单击向下箭头,可以看到包括“自定义”、“对象类型”、“表和相关视图”、“创建日期”、“修改日期”和“按组筛选”等多种组织方式。2.4.3数据库对象的组织自定义组织方式很灵活,在这种方式下可以按需组织数据库对象。具体操作步骤如下。1.启动Access2010,打开任意一个数据库文件。在导航窗格中,单击“自定义”按钮。2.此时,创建了一个自定义组,名为“自定义组1”。如图所示。自定义组织方式操作步骤3.此时,从导航窗格下方的“未分配的对象”中把需要的对象拖入自定义组1中。4.此时,若要“按组筛选”对象的话,则分组如图所示。自定义组织方式操作步骤2.对象类型在此组织方式下,对数据库的所有对象按照表、查询、窗体、报表等对象的类型进行组织。3.表和相关视图在Access中提供了一种新的数据库对象的组织方式,就是表和相关视图方式。这种方式的出发点是数据库对象的逻辑关系。在Access数据库中,表是最基本的对象。查询、窗体、报表、视图都是依赖于表而存在的。因此,这些对象和某个基本表存在逻辑关系。这种组织方式,无疑正好提供了了解数据库内部对象之间逻辑关系的一个很好的机会。数据库对象的组织在Access数据库中可以对表、查询、窗体等各种对象进行打开、关闭、插入、复制和删除等多种操作。2.4.4数据库对象的操作打开数据库对象如果需要打开某个数据库对象,在导航窗格中,选中所需要打开的对象,双击就可以直接打开所选中的对象,非常方便。关闭对象Access2010中已经打开的所有对象,采用选项卡的方式展示在窗口中。当打开了多个对象以后,如果需要关闭其中的某个对象,只需要单击该对象对应的选项卡右上角的关闭图标按钮,若将鼠标指向该按钮,则会弹出“关闭XXX”的提示信息。数据库对象的操作复制数据库对象在Access2010中,使用复制方法可以快速获得对象的副本。以“教职员”数据库为例,具体操作步骤如下。1.启动Access2010,打开“教职员”数据库文件。在左侧的导航窗格中可以看到所有的数据库对象。2.选中需要复制的对象,此处以“教职员通讯簿”为例。右击鼠标,在弹出的快捷菜单中选择“复制”命令。如图所示。复制数据库对象操作步骤3.在导航窗格中,任意位置右击鼠标,在弹出的快捷菜单中选择“粘贴”命令,如图所示,出现“粘贴为”对话框,此时可以重命名对象,也可以直接使用副本名称。命名后,单击“确定”按钮。完成复制对象操作。复制数据库对象操作步骤4.删除数据库对象如果要删除某个数据库对象,需要先关闭该对象,而且不能使被删除的对象出现在选项卡文档窗格中。如果是多用户工作环境,应该保证所有用户都没有打开该数据库对象。以“教职员”数据库为例,具体操作步骤如下。删除数据库对象1.启动Access2010,打开“教职员”数据库文件。在左侧的导航窗格中可以看到所有的数据库对象。2.选中需要复制的对象,此处以“教职员电话列表”报表为例。右击鼠标,在弹出的快捷菜单中选择“删除”命令。3.如图所示,弹出警告信息:“是否永久删除“报表‘教职员电话列表’”?如果单击“是”,您将不能恢复这个删除操作。”4.确定要删除该对象是,单击“是”按钮,完成删除操作。删除数据库对象操作步骤实训要求:新建“客户”数据库,要求从罗斯文数据库中复制“客户”表和“客户通讯簿”报表对象到新建的数据库中。2.5小型案例实训1.启动Access2010,如图2-1所示,单击屏幕左上角的【文件】标签,在打开的Backstage视图中选择【新建】命令,然后单击【样本模版】图标按钮。此时,进入“可用模版”界面,从列出的12个模板中选择需要的模板,这里选择【罗斯文数据库】选项,如图所示。实训步骤2.在屏幕右下方弹出的【数据库名称】中输入想要采用的数据库文件名,然后单击【创建】按钮,完成数据库的创建。创建的数据库如图所示。实训步骤3.在窗口中部的黄色警告
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- DB32T-建筑工程BIM规划报建数据规范编制说明
- 给予是快乐的课件公开课专用
- 《口腔洁治课件》课件
- 基因工程的基本操作程序课件
- 《TA沟通分析课程》课件
- 《伊犁河大桥》课件
- 生活处处有哲学课件
- 单位管理制度展示汇编【员工管理篇】
- 中国武都头风痛丸项目投资可行性研究报告
- 单位管理制度收录大全职员管理篇十篇
- 2024-2025学年人教版数学五年级上册期末检测试卷(含答案)
- 广西玉林市(2024年-2025年小学六年级语文)统编版质量测试(上学期)试卷及答案
- 《外盘期货常识》课件
- 【MOOC】土力学-西安交通大学 中国大学慕课MOOC答案
- 医院医保科工作总结
- 2024-2025学年译林版八年级英语上学期重点词汇短语句子归纳【考点清单】
- 广东省六校联考2024-2025学年高二上学期12月月考英语试题
- 养老护理员技能培训的标准化实施方案
- 2024年企业采购部年终总结及今后计划(3篇)
- 物业客服个人述职报告范例
- 数据岗位招聘笔试题与参考答案2024年
评论
0/150
提交评论